Benchmarks: The Direct Hire Landscape

In 2011, we estimate that the U.S. direct hire market generated $5.1 billion. In direct hire service, the staffing supplier is engaged to fill a permanent role for a client, and only charges a fee if the position is filled. (This does not include retained search, when the staffing supplier is paid regardless of whether the position is filled). Commercial staffing (industrial and office/clerical), which is roughly half of temporary staffing revenue, makes up only 16 percent of the direct hire market. Information technology is the largest segment, making up a quarter of the direct hire market.
